Holiday party hosted by ADTC on Dec. 11
The Association of Defense Trial Counsel (ADTC) will host its Annual Holiday Meeting on Tuesday, Dec. 11, with cocktails and a buffet dinner from 6 to 8 p.m. at Amnesia Night Club at the Motor City Hotel, 2901 Grand River Ave. in Detroit.
Cost to attend is $50 for ADTC members and $55 for non-members. Price includes two drink tickets, entertainment by Keith Malinowski Duo, and complimentary valet parking. Amnesia Night Club is located on the 16th floor of the hotel. Attendees should take the elevator in the hotel lobby and do not have to enter the casino in order to access Amnesia.
To confirm attendance, contact Diane Hirshey at 313-237-0610 by noon on Friday, Dec. 7.
